    Product Overview

    Most traditional threat intelligence relies on honeypots, which only catch cybercriminals who are blindly scanning the internet. The CrowdSec Intelligence Blocklist (CIB) takes a fundamentally different and more effective approach: it is fueled by a global network effect of over 400,000 real, highly diversified servers protecting actual businesses. Because we protect real workloads, we catch targeted, complex, and costly attacks that honeypots simply miss. Our worldwide network processes around 40-50 million aggressions daily, distilling them into a highly curated, real-time blocklist of the most aggressive cybercriminal IP addresses. By leveraging this "digital herd immunity," your AWS infrastructure benefits from crowdsourced protection that is consistently 1 to 10 weeks ahead of traditional intelligence providers. In fact, 36% of the IP addresses on our high-threat list were exclusive to CrowdSec when first published. Leverage our unique network effect to your benefit

    • Real Workloads vs. Honeypots: Cybercriminals adapt to honeypots, but they cannot evade the defenses of real, production environments. CrowdSec captures data from real customers actively targeted by attackers, yielding actionable and high-fidelity intelligence.
    • Zero False Positives: We employ a rigorous Consensus Algorithm that analyzes sightings across multiple autonomous systems. IPs are only blocked if reported by enough trusted network members over time, ensuring zero false positives and immunity to adversarial poisoning.
    • Real-Time Actionability: IP addresses are dynamically added and removed by the minute based on their ongoing aggressivity, ensuring your defenses are never stale.
    • Massive Cost & Resource Optimization: Blocking threats at Layer 3 with CIB prevents attacks from taxing your application resources. Customers typically see a 14% reduction in cloud computing bills and up to a 60% reduction in SIEM log ingestion costs. Furthermore, eliminating this background noise reduces alert fatigue (dropping alerts by 82%) and saves Security Operations Centers (SOCs) the equivalent of 2 to 3 full-time employees' workloads.

    Key Capabilities & Protection

    The CrowdSec Intelligence Blocklist seamlessly integrates into your AWS edge filtering (such as AWS WAF or Network Firewall) to provide immediate, plug-and-play protection. It actively shields your infrastructure from:

    • Vulnerability Exploitation: Proactively blocks CVE hunters attempting to exploit known and emerging vulnerabilities.
    • Credential Attacks: Stops brute-force attempts, credential stuffing, and injection attacks.
    • Web & API Abuse: Mitigates Layer 7 (application) DDoS attacks, cross-site scripting (XSS), and SQL injection attacks.
    • Automated Fraud: Thwarts scalping bots, credit card stuffing, and massive network scanning.

    By implementing the CrowdSec Intelligence Blocklist, 92% of attacks can be preemptively blocked at the edge without requiring any further application-level treatment, drastically improving your security posture with nearly zero installation time.

    IPs do not stay forever. An address kept in the source database is removed after 72 hours if it shows no further aggressive activity, treating it as cleaned or a variable IP. Lists refresh continuously, so what you block reflects currently active threats rather than a static permanent set.
